There is a lot of pressure and responsibility once you become a Derby Winner or returning Horse of the Year. The fans want to see you again and they want to see you win.

Shipping out to the Malibu and running in the Old Strub Series might have been how they used to do it. And being there on Pegasus day might be how we currently do it (Knicks Go. Life is Good, Gun Runner). But is/was this the best route for the horse?

Dan and the Barn gave a good account of themselves yesterday. Foster Day should be outstanding with Thorpedo Anna running. The Derby wasn\'t a fluke or lucky. Dan proved he is a good horse. A great horse is to be determined.
